PAUL SÉRUSIER | Rivière d’Argent au Huelgoat

Estimate
25,000 - 35,000 USD
bidding is closed

Description

  • Paul Sérusier
  • Rivière d’Argent au Huelgoat
  • Stamped with the initials PS (lower right)
  • Pastel and brush and ink on paper
  • 12 by 9 1/2 in.
  • 31.1 by 24.1 cm
Executed in 1895.

Provenance

Henriette Boutaric, Paris (and sold by the estate: Ader-Picard-Tajan, Paris, June 19-20, 1984, lot 363)
Galerie Hopkins-Thomas, Paris
Acquired from the above on November 24, 1995

Literature

Marcel Guicheteau, Paul Sérusier, vol. II, Pontoise, 1989, no. 73, illustrated p. 98

Condition

The work is executed on buff-colored wove paper. The sheet is T-hinged to a mount along the upper edge of its verso. There is a 1.5 inch diagonal tear extending from the center of the right edge. Two minor nicks along center of the left edge. The work is in good condition overall.
